What is DMSO?

Dimethyl sulfoxide originates from Germany, according to Healthline. It was discovered in the late 19th century as a by-product of the process used to make paper. DMSO is used as a topical medication to speed the healing process of burns, wounds and muscle injuries, according to WebMD. It can also be used to treat headache, inflammation, osteoarthritis, bunions and glaucoma. In addition to being used topically, DMSO can also be taken orally or injected intravenously.

Why might a menstrual flow be brown?

The menstrual cycle can last from 2 to 7 days. During that time, the blood color can change from bright red to dark brown, which is normal. The consistency of the blood can also vary throughout the cycle. At the beginning of the cycle, blood flow can be thicker, heavier and contain some clots. A reason for concern is when there are many large clots or regular heavy periods, which is when a physician should be consulted, states WebMD.

Why is a low-fat diet recommended for those with gallbladder problems?

The gallbladder is responsible for storing, concentrating and secreting bile, Everyday Health explains. Bile is a liquid produced by the liver that supports the digestion of fats. After surgery, the liver continues to produce normal quantities of bile but no longer has the gallbladder to assist in the process. As a result, bile is secreted directly into the small intestine at a constant rate. Eventually the digestive system adjusts to the change, but the patient may need to avoid certain foods in the interim. What is severe sleep apnea?

There are two primary types of sleep apnea, according to WebMD. Obstructive sleep apnea is the most common of the two, and it is caused by a blockage of the airway in the back of the throat. Central sleep apnea, on the other hand, occurs when the brain is unable to send messages to the muscles that tell them to breathe.\nWhen left untreated, severe sleep apnea can cause additional heath issues, states WebMD. What are some ways to predict when your next period will be?

Women can include the following information when tracking their menstrual cycle: start date, end date, flow, pain, changes and abnormal bleeding, notes Mayo Clinic. Counting the days between periods will help determine the length of a woman's cycle. Another option is to enter the information in an online calculator, such as the one provided by Kotex, to automatically determine the dates of future periods.
